I think Yorkshire is even more skinny then Silky...The Yorkshire Terrier is a dog with maximum weight of 2-3kg and Silky Terrier will weight 4-5kg. Yorkshire Terrier has much less muscle and body weight than a Silky Terrier, and is very refined in bone. They also have a more rounded, dome-shaped skull, large round eyes and a short muzzle. A Silky Terrier will have a longer, more wedge shape to the head with a flatter skull and an almond shape to the eye. Silky Terrier are quite similar in temperaments, a true terrier. Yorkshire is a 'small' terrier but does like to be a pampered 'pillow' dog whereas the Silky Terrier is more independent in nature. This post has been edited by lovepassion: May 19 2007, 02:00 PM |

QUOTE(babymiki @ May 19 2007, 12:44 AM) Information courtesy of Fordogonly.net Jack Russell Terrier Coat: The Jack Russell Terrier has a dense double-coat that comes in three varieties: smooth, rough, and broken. The smooth coat has an outer-coat that is short and stiff. In the rough coat the outer-coat is longer. The broken variety is used to describe both dogs with outer-coats of different lengths or dogs that have longer hair on specific parts of the body. The Jack Russell Terrier is primarily white with black, tan, or tri-color markings. They shed constantly. Plucking is necessary to remove old fur, in order for the new coat to come out.
